    Arbitration vs. Trial. What is arbitration and why would you do arbitration? Court systems are going virtual, meaning trials are not happening. Courts are starting to send cases to non-binding arbitration. But how does that affect homeowners, personal injury victims, etc.? And what is binding vs. non-binding arbitration?
